Safety

If you're considering bunk beds for your children, it's important to consider safety concerns first. The fall of bunks could result in serious injuries, particularly when they occur when your child is asleep or playing. Additionally, bunk bed structures that fall on children could result in head injuries like concussions, bruises and bumps and traumatic brain injuries (TBI).

The majority of bunk beds have guardrails on the top bunk. This prevents falls. However, these aren't always tall enough to protect a child from a serious fall, which could be fatal. Luckily, the Consumer Product Safety Commission (CPSC) requires bunk bed manufacturers to follow a number of safety standards to prevent these tragic accidents.

Entrapment is among the most frequent hazards of bunk beds. Children can be trapped in the gap between the bunks that are lower and upper, which may lead to strangulation or suffocation. Bunk beds can collapse on children because of poor construction or defective parts.

To reduce the risk of injuries resulting from bunk beds Make sure you keep the area surrounding the bed free of toys, books or other items your child might climb into. Also, make sure to regularly inspect the bunk bed for cracks or breakages in the corner supports. If you spot any, contact the store who sold you the bunk bed for repair instructions. If the bunk remains unstable, you can call the importer for a replacement.

Another safety consideration when buying bunk beds is the weight limit for each mattress. Most bunk beds are designed for children and have a maximum weight of 160 pounds. However, you can also find full-over-full bunk beds that have higher weight capacities that can accommodate adult sleepers.

Finally, you should choose the bunk bed constructed from high-quality materials. Look for wood that is Greenguard Gold Certified and low in volatile organic compounds (VOCs), which can contaminate indoor air. It is also recommended to choose a bunk that has been inspected by a third party and that meets CPSC safety requirements. Ideally, the bunk should include a ladder with an angled design that makes it easier for kids to climb up and down.
